Create an embedded Derby database Ajax application

Derby is a great database for Ajax applications -- particularly if the client and server are on the same host -- due to Derby's zero admin requirements and ability to be embedded. This article explains all the steps and requirements to create an embedded database and Web server application. The source code and a ready to run application provided as a zip file are available for download. The Derby database acts as the data repository, the Jetty Web server or servlet container handles the HTTP requests, and Ajax technologies are used to enhance the presentation and responsiveness of the client.
